32 lines
639 B
C#
32 lines
639 B
C#
namespace RedHotRoast
|
|
{
|
|
using System.Collections.Generic;
|
|
|
|
public class JoastModel : BaseModel
|
|
{
|
|
protected override void OnInit()
|
|
{
|
|
}
|
|
|
|
protected override void OnDispose()
|
|
{
|
|
}
|
|
|
|
private Queue<JoastData> tipsDatas = new Queue<JoastData>();
|
|
|
|
public void AddTips(JoastData joastData)
|
|
{
|
|
if (tipsDatas.Count > 0)
|
|
{
|
|
return;
|
|
}
|
|
|
|
tipsDatas.Enqueue(joastData);
|
|
}
|
|
|
|
public JoastData GetTips()
|
|
{
|
|
return tipsDatas.Count > 0 ? tipsDatas.Dequeue() : null;
|
|
}
|
|
}
|
|
} |